206GTi "rumble" when changing gear
-> 206 Problems

#1: 206GTi "rumble" when changing gear Author: p4ul PostPosted: Fri Jun 28, 2013 7:05 am
    ----
Hi there guys,

Basically, pulling off in first, moving into second and occasionally even third produces a rumble under the car. I can't locate it, but I have been advised by a colleague at work that it could be a clutch plate problem? Also, someone suggested that a mount somewhere could be loose?

I realize there are other similar problems on here, but no one has specifically addressed the problem as a rumble so I think thats where I differ.

Any help or advice is welcome, I can also post a video if my phone can pick up the noise.

Cheers, Paul

#2: Re: 206GTi "rumble" when changing gear Author: Big_Rich180 PostPosted: Fri Jun 28, 2013 7:27 am
    ----
Clutch release bearing?

#3: Re: 206GTi "rumble" when changing gear Author: magistar, Location: new zealand PostPosted: Fri Jun 28, 2013 8:11 am
    ----
Clutch judder? Does it only happen when you're releasing the clutch pedal or while you're changing gears
